Course structure

• Understanding the Impact of Infidelity on Military Relationships
• Communication Strategies for Rebuilding Trust
• Coping Mechanisms for Individuals Affected by Infidelity
• Legal and Ethical Considerations in Military Infidelity Cases
• Counseling Approaches for Couples Dealing with Infidelity
• Cultural and Gender Dynamics in Military Infidelity
• Role of Social Support in Healing from Infidelity
• Self-Care Practices for Individuals Supporting Partners through Infidelity
• Technology and Infidelity in Military Relationships
• Building Resilience and Moving Forward After Infidelity
